Design Considerations: What to Check Before Using
Before using the Nurse Mother Coffee Lover Retro Design in a client project, there are several practical steps a designer should take. First, test it in black and white to see how it holds up without color. Check contrast on both light and dark backgrounds to ensure readability.
Preview the design at various sizes—smaller dimensions might lose some of its detail, while larger ones could become too busy. Place it on real mockups to see how it integrates with other elements. If it’s a SVG design or PNG design, inspect the transparency and editability to ensure it meets your needs.
Also, compare it with different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, or display fonts—to see how it pairs. Confirm that the commercial license covers all intended uses, especially if it’s for a small business branding or handmade business project.
